Understanding the Banking and Financial Services sector
The BFS sector includes banks, non-banking financial companies (NBFCs), insurance providers, fintech firms, and capital market participants that facilitate the movement of money and credit in the economy. Supported by ongoing reforms and digital innovation, the sector continues to evolve, broadening access and participation across customer segments.
Technology: UPI and digital payments transforming financial transactions
India’s digital transformation is redefining how transactions take place. Non-cash transactions for Indian households are projected to increase from 38% in FY23 to 62% in FY28. Tier 2 and smaller cities are expected to drive over 80% of the estimated USD 60 billion in digital lending disbursements by FY28.

Economic: Financial inclusion through Jan Dhan expansion
Financial inclusion continues to be an area of focus for policymakers. The number of Jan Dhan accounts has risen nearly 18 times, from 33 million in FY14 to 540 million in FY24, mobilising deposits of around Rs. 2.3 trillion. These accounts have also supported the direct transfer of benefits to citizens, improving efficiency in welfare delivery.

Demographic: A growing working-age population and rising prosperity
India’s young workforce continues to influence consumption and savings patterns. A larger share of households is entering middle- and high-income categories, with projections suggesting that nearly 75% may fall within these groups by 2030.

Social: Fintech innovation expanding access to credit
Fintech firms are playing a growing role in expanding access to credit, particularly among first-time borrowers and small enterprises. Using technology and alternative data, they are helping to reach underserved segments, including women entrepreneurs and rural borrowers.
As new business models emerge in response to changing consumer preferences, the BFS sector may see continued diversification and innovation.
